I FEEL that I exposed myself to a most alarming comparison in consenting to write 'A History of Scotland for the Young '-a comparison which I most earnestly deprecate, and implore the gentle reader, even the critic whose part it is not to be gentle but just, not to make. I am told, though it is scarcely my own opinion, that each generation has need of its own books, notwithstanding the existence of much better books belonging to an earlier time. Our much-beloved Sir Walter, ever gentle, ever kind, will forgive the grandmother who comes humbly after hiln. I trust that all who take this little book in hand will do so too.
